http://aeb019.hosted.uark.edu/pplane.html WebThis is the force per unit charge. E → = F → / q. The electric field is often visualised using field lines, which are what you can see in the interactive demo at the top of the page. Electric field lines follow a number of rules. They always point in the direction of the electric field at a given point. This direction is represented by an ...
Webequation, a graphical method call direction fields or slope fields. You will learn how to draw direction fields by hand. That method is a bit tedious, but I hope will give you a foundation for understanding what you will see when we use Desmos to … WebA slope field, also called a direction field, is a graphical aid for understanding a differential equation, formed by: Choosing a grid of points. At each point, computing the slope given by the differential equation, …
